groovy.sql
Class BatchingStatementWrapper
java.lang.Object
groovy.lang.GroovyObjectSupport
groovy.sql.BatchingStatementWrapper
- All Implemented Interfaces:
- GroovyObject
public class BatchingStatementWrapper
- extends GroovyObjectSupport
Class which delegates to a Statement but keeps track of
a batch count size. If the batch count reaches the predefined number,
this Statement does an executeBatch() automatically. If batchSize is
zero, then no batching is performed.
